jquery - datepicker 禁用基于时间的日期

标签 jquery datepicker

我的网站上有一个日期选择器,但现在我想禁用基于时间的日期。我想实现两件事:

  1. 我想禁用今天,用户应该无法选择今天的日期。
  2. 每天下午 2:00 之后我也想在明天停用。

可以通过jquery实现吗?

最佳答案

根据一天中的时间更改 minDate 怎么样?

var hour = new Date().getHours();
$("element").datepicker({ minDate: hour >= 14 ? 2 : 1});

关于jquery - datepicker 禁用基于时间的日期,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11713125/

相关文章:

jQuery UI Spinner 不显示带有货币名称的美元符号

javascript - 如何设置日期选择器 Bootstrap

javascript - 没有输入的 jQuery 日期选择器

jquery-ui - jQuery DatePicker 太大

javascript - 将日期发送到 JavaScript 中的操作

c# - 如何从代码后面打开日期选择器的日历?

jquery - 为所有日期选择器设置属性,也可以单独设置属性

jquery - 如何使用 jQuery 将鼠标悬停在 div 上时显示覆盖 div?

javascript - 在javascript中验证选择框

jquery - $(this).keyup() 专注于tinyMCE时没有响应